If anybody is still looking to find out how to to get the id in a post grid or create a specific widget for the grid you can use the following snippet I creatd for adding an icon before the post title. You will see inside the first function you can call $post-ID
for use on any query.
//** Case Study Title Block Shortcodes ***********
//********************************
add_filter( 'vc_gitem_template_attribute_case_study_title','vc_gitem_template_attribute_case_study_title', 10, 2 );
function vc_gitem_template_attribute_case_study_title( $value, $data ) {
extract( array_merge( array(
'post' => null,
'data' => '',
), $data ) );
$atts_extended = array();
parse_str( $data, $atts_extended );
$atts = $atts_extended['atts'];
// write all your widget code in here using queries etc
$title = get_the_title($post->ID);
$link = get_permalink($post->ID);
$terms = get_the_terms($post->ID, 'case_categories');
$output = "<h4 class=\"case-title\"><a href=\"". $link ."\">". get_the_icon($terms[0]->term_id) . $title ."</a></h4>";
return $output;
}
add_filter( 'vc_grid_item_shortcodes', 'case_study_title_shortcodes' );
function case_study_title_shortcodes( $shortcodes ) {
$shortcodes['vc_case_study_title'] = array(
'name' => __( 'Case Study Title', 'sage' ),
'base' => 'vc_case_study_title',
'icon' => get_template_directory_uri() . '/assets/images/icon.svg',
'category' => __( 'Content', 'sage' ),
'description' => __( 'Displays the case study title with correct icon', 'sage' ),
'post_type' => Vc_Grid_Item_Editor::postType()
);
return $shortcodes;
}
add_shortcode( 'vc_case_study_title', 'vc_case_study_title_render' );
function vc_case_study_title_render($atts){
$atts = vc_map_get_attributes( 'vc_case_study_title', $atts );
return '{{ case_study_title }}';
}
